Biography

Amanda Palmer (born April 30, 1976) is an American performer, director, composer and musician, who came first to prominence as the lead singer, keyboardist and songwriter of [a=The Dresden Dolls]. In 2008 she released her first solo album. Her main instrument is the Piano but close second became the Ukulele. [Link] released in 2012, credited to [a2644173], was completely funded by her supporters and became the top crowd-funded music project even reaching the Billboard Top Ten. She published her best-selling memoir [Link] in late 2014 detailing her artistic points of view and her personal experiences as street performer through Grand Central. Consequently on March 2015, she started using Patreon as her main source of her income and a better way of direct communication with her fans and community. Her 2019 solo album and the accompanying tour had life, death, abortion, and miscarriage among its main themes. She was married to writer [a=Neil Gaiman] from 2011 to 2022. She has one child, Anthony “Ash” Palmer Gaiman.
